    Overnight repaving starts on N. Academy near Voyager

    (COLORADO SPRINGS) — Starting Sunday, Sept. 8, North Academy Boulevard will have overnight closures for three weeks between Voyager and Shrider roads for 2C repaving work .

    Lane closures will begin at 7 p.m. and end at 7 a.m. daily to reduce traffic disruptions on the busy north-south corridor. Drivers should detour to East Woodmen Road or avoid the area. At least one lane in each direction will remain open overnight.

    Milling operations are set for the week of Sept. 8, with asphalt installation planned for the week of Sept. 15. Work is expected to finish by the end of September, weather permitting.

    The voter-approved 2C Road Improvements program funds the project, aimed at improving road conditions in Colorado Springs.
